As a Veterinary Assistant, you'll work alongside our doctors and licensed technicians to deliver excellent patient care and keep the hospital running smoothly. Responsibilities include:
• Assisting veterinarians and LVTs during examinations, treatments, and procedures.
• Safe and compassionate handling and restraint of dogs and cats.
• Performing venipuncture, collecting samples, and running in-house lab work.
• Preparing samples for outside reference labs.
• Administering vaccines, medications, and treatments under veterinarian supervision.
• Assisting with surgical prep, patient monitoring, and recovery.
• Taking radiographs and performing other diagnostic support as needed.
• Communicating with clients regarding patient care, home instructions, and follow-up.
• Maintaining accurate medical records and entering charges.
• Keeping exam rooms, treatment areas, and equipment clean, stocked, and ready.
• Supporting general kennel and facility maintenance. Who You Are
• Previous experience in a veterinary setting preferred; motivated entry-level candidates considered.
• Comfortable with venipuncture, lab procedures, and basic clinical tasks.
• Able to safely and compassionately handle dogs and cats.
• Clear communicator with clients, doctors, and teammates.
• Organized and calm in a fast-paced hospital environment.
• Reliable, punctual, and accountable.
• Eager to learn and grow professionally.
• Comfortable with computers and practice management software.
• Able to lift and restrain pets as needed. What We Offer
